Best Davison County Private Preschools (2026-27)

For the 2026-27 school year, there are 2 private preschools serving 322 students in Davison County, SD.
The average acceptance rate is 90%, which is higher than the South Dakota private preschool average acceptance rate of 0%.
100% of private preschools in Davison County, SD are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ic and Other).
